[heathkit] SB-101 adjustment problems.



Title: SB-101 adjustment problems.
I am going through the tuning procedures for the SB-101 (btw, the crystal replacement went well and all is working on that band)..
I am having some s-meter problems occurring when I do the  adjustments.  First, the HV setting the reading looks good on the meter, maybe a bit low but since the rig is working I can over look this.  Second.. When I went to zero the s-meter (pg93) I noticed that the potentiometer had to be placed all the way to the fully counter clockwise position before it would zero.  If you turned it clockwise at all it would dip to the below zero state.  But it did reach mostly zero so I moved on.  Third.. I noticed that when you switched it over to the 100-khz generator and tried to tune in the different bands on the receiver side, the S meter didn’t move at all.. The tone changed as the adjustments “came in” but there was no s-meter activity.  I haven't noticed any s-meter activity when listing to stations coming into the rig either.  Has anyone run into this problem before.. Any idea’s would be appreciated.
